On external backgrounds and linear potential in three dimensions
Abstract
For a three-dimensional theory with a coupling $ϕε^{μνλ} v_μF_{νλ}$, where $v_μ$ is an external constant background, we compute the interaction potential within the structure of the gauge-invariant but path-dependent variables formalism. While in the case of a purely timelike vector the static potential remains Coulombic, in the case of a purely spacelike vector the potential energy is the sum of a Bessel and a linear potentials, leading to the confinement of static charges. This result may be considered as another realization of the known Polyakov's result.
